What is a Smart Grid?
The integration of communications networks with the power grid in order to create an electricity-communications superhighway capable of monitoring its own health at all times, alerting officials immediately when problems arise and automatically taking corrective actions that enable the grid to fail gracefully and prevent a local failure from cascading out of control, as happened August 14, 2003
(The Great Northeast Blackout).

The RuggedSwitch™ family of Ethernet Switch products offer such industry leading features as:
Zero-Packet-Loss technology for error free operation under severe EMI (electromagnetic interference)conditions. They also qualify as an IEEE 1613 Class 2 error free device for
substation applications.
High speed network fault recovery with eRSTP (enhanced Rapid Spanning Tree) offering
sub 5ms speeds.
Wide operating temperature range (-40 to +85C) without the use of fans.
Maximizing network availability with dual redundant parallel load-sharing power supplies that can be powered from different power sources (eg. ac source and station battery)
Support for short-haul fiber optical media for intra-substation networking and long-haul fiber
optical mediafor high-speed (1000Mbps) inter-substation communications using native Ethernet up to 90km per hop.
Network level security features for NERC CIP compliance
